How to Choose the Right MAX4382EUD Operational Amplifiers, Instrumentation Amplifiers and Buffer Amplifiers

📦

Match the footprint first

Packages here: 14-TSSOP (0.173", 4.40mm Width). Open the land-pattern drawing before you substitute a different suffix.

Electrical headroom

Compare voltage and current columns in the variant table. For MAX4382EUD, a suffix with lower voltage or current rating will not survive the same circuit without recalculation.

🌡️

Temp grade letter matters

Commercial (0–70 °C) and industrial (−40–85 °C+) suffixes look similar in the prefix — confirm ambient + self-heating, not just the first page of the datasheet.

🔢

Copy the full MPN

Do not BOM only "MAX4382EUD" — include the full suffix (e.g. +, +T). RFQ with reel/tube preference and required date code.
